summ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Andrei Karas <akaras@inbox.ru>2012-08-16 00:00:57 +0300
committerAndrei Karas <akaras@inbox.ru>2012-08-16 00:25:36 +0300
commitb30df9b843eae2128431320308510f13296e3e7f (patch)
treeaeaebc3595508700e2b7313c2252b446212d25d5
parentb5f95469e5e8970407036471a2ae37148f044481 (diff)
downloadmanaverse-b30df9b843eae2128431320308510f13296e3e7f.tar.gz
manaverse-b30df9b843eae2128431320308510f13296e3e7f.tar.bz2
manaverse-b30df9b843eae2128431320308510f13296e3e7f.tar.xz
manaverse-b30df9b843eae2128431320308510f13296e3e7f.zip
Fix compilation errors.
-rw-r--r--src/graphicsmanager.cpp6
-rw-r--r--src/gui/questswindow.h1
-rw-r--r--src/utils/copynpaste.cpp3
3 files changed, 9 insertions, 1 deletions
diff --git a/src/graphicsmanager.cpp b/src/graphicsmanager.cpp
index 5a02b1776..86814b4be 100644
--- a/src/graphicsmanager.cpp
+++ b/src/graphicsmanager.cpp
@@ -214,6 +214,7 @@ Graphics *GraphicsManager::createGraphics()
void GraphicsManager::updateExtensions()
{
+#ifdef USE_OPENGL
mExtensions.clear();
logger->log1("opengl extensions: ");
if (checkGLVersion(3, 0))
@@ -238,10 +239,12 @@ void GraphicsManager::updateExtensions()
splitToStringSet(mExtensions, extensions, ' ');
}
+#endif
}
void GraphicsManager::updatePlanformExtensions()
{
+#ifdef USE_OPENGL
SDL_SysWMinfo info;
SDL_VERSION(&info.version);
if (SDL_GetWMInfo(&info))
@@ -315,6 +318,7 @@ void GraphicsManager::updatePlanformExtensions()
}
#endif
}
+#endif
}
bool GraphicsManager::supportExtension(const std::string &ext)
@@ -552,6 +556,7 @@ void GraphicsManager::deleteFBO(FBOInfo *fbo)
void GraphicsManager::initOpenGLFunctions()
{
+#ifdef USE_OPENGL
if (!checkGLVersion(1, 1))
return;
@@ -591,4 +596,5 @@ void GraphicsManager::initOpenGLFunctions()
#ifdef WIN32
assignFunction(wglGetExtensionsString, "wglGetExtensionsStringARB");
#endif
+#endif
}
diff --git a/src/gui/questswindow.h b/src/gui/questswindow.h
index 0c4d5789e..706f6ba1c 100644
--- a/src/gui/questswindow.h
+++ b/src/gui/questswindow.h
@@ -30,6 +30,7 @@
#include <guichan/actionlistener.hpp>
#include <map>
+#include <vector>
class Button;
class BrowserBox;
diff --git a/src/utils/copynpaste.cpp b/src/utils/copynpaste.cpp
index 94cfe9589..461de1001 100644
--- a/src/utils/copynpaste.cpp
+++ b/src/utils/copynpaste.cpp
@@ -33,8 +33,9 @@
# include "config.h"
#endif
+#include "utils/copynpaste.h"
+
#include <SDL_syswm.h>
-#include "copynpaste.h"
#include "debug.h"